"Figure 7: More than half of female pupils in school Years 7 to 13 have thought they were fat even when people told them they were very thin","" "Proportion of secondary school pupils in school Years 7 to 13 who answered “yes” to various questions on eating behaviours, by gender. England, March 2022","" "","" "Notes","1. Questions used from the pupil questionnaire are as presented. Note that the wording of the first question is slightly ambiguous, as in Figure 4. 2. Base: All female and male pupils in years 7 to 13 who answered each question (n = 1,624 to 1,631 females and 1,315 to 1,318 males). " "Unit","Percentages" "","" "","Female","Male" "Have you ever thought that you were fat even when other people have told you that you were or that you are very thin?","52.3","23.0" "If you eat too much do you blame yourself a lot? ","36.7","16.9" "Do you have worries about eating (what? where? how much?) that really interfere with your life?","32.6","14.8" "Would you be ashamed if other people knew how much you eat? ","27.9","8.9" "Have you ever deliberately made yourself vomit (throw up)?","11.4","2.3"
